Bio

Adult Swim Senior Director Of Adult Swim Events & Talent January 2012 - Present Executive in charge of strategy for Adult Swim events and activations as well as talent relations for the network. Developed innovative events for Adult Swim, including the Adult Swim Fun House (Named Adweek’s Best in Show at SDCC 2013) as well as live adaptations of Adult Swim programs, including Dethklok, Eric Andre, Tim and Eric, and most recently an Adventure Time musical adaptation and most recently a pop-up drive-in experience. Oversees Adult Swim presence at San Diego and New York Comic Con. Works closely with Turner Ad Sales and Branded Entertainment to create and sell projects to brand partners, including multiple college tours. Reports directly to the head of Adult Swim, Mike Lazzo. Adult Swim Director of Music January 2007–December 2011 Executive in charge of Cartoon Network’s music division. Responsible for building a record label and music strategy for Cartoon Network and Adult Swim. Developed music initiatives such as the Singles Program that continue to be sold to brand partners. Music supervisor on all Cartoon Network and Adult Swim series. Adult Swim/Cartoon Network Label Manager, Williams Street Records January 2007-January 2009 Velocette Records Co-Owner/President 2001–2006 Founded independent record label in 2001. Ran daily operations including administering recording funds to artists, managing inventory, and all marketing and promotion. Home to bands Beulah, Jucifer, The Glands, Vic Chesnutt, The Party of Helicopters, Brass Castle, Jack Logan, Brute and Kevn Kinney. Capricorn Records Director of Product Development 1999-2001 Supervised all aspects of touring, marketing and promotion for label’s artists, including such multi-platinum acts as 311, Cake and Widespread Panic. Education School of the Art Institute of Chicago Chicago, IL 1993–1996 BFA PHOTOGRAPHY/FILM 1996 Studio Art Centers International Florence, Italy 1992–1993 Bennington College Bennington, VT 1991-1992 Awards Event Tech Awards 2014 Silver Award for Best Use Of Projection Mapping for Meatwad Full Dome Experience Silver Award for Best Use Of Event Technology and Data Collection for Adult Swim Fun House and Meatwad Full Dome Experience Professional Activity Georgia Music Foundation Board Member 2012-Present Guest Lecturer and Board Member of University of Georgia’s Music Business School 2006-Present
